Samoa Covid infections increase in 35 to 55 age group

The latest report released Tuesday by the Government said data shows that the prevalence of Covid-19 infection is significantly higher among those aged from 15 to 35

There were 129 new confirmed community cases recorded as at 2pm Tuesday, 29 March 2022.

The number of community cases recorded since 17 March 2022 currently stands at 1,493 of which 1,330 are active community cases.

Upolu accounts for 97 percent of total confirmed community cases with the remaining three percent in Savaii.
